[balsa/52-fix-clang-9-fails] meson.build: Add -Wenum-conversion flag



commit e086fdbea97ac4282588f64ac6e35a80aa05ca29
Author: Peter Bloomfield <PeterBloomfield bellsouth net>
Date:   Mon Jan 11 17:54:39 2021 -0500

    meson.build: Add -Wenum-conversion flag
    
    It should be enabled by default, but doesn't seem to be. Meson's default
    warn-level uses -Wall, and the gcc docs say that that implies
    -Wenum-conversion. However, without the flag set explicitly, gcc does
    not detect enum-conversion errors. So we'll just set it.

 meson.build | 1 +
 1 file changed, 1 insertion(+)
---
diff --git a/meson.build b/meson.build
index d930e271b..8539d041b 100644
--- a/meson.build
+++ b/meson.build
@@ -456,6 +456,7 @@ if balsa_from_git
     '-Wformat',
     '-Wformat-security',
     '-Wignored-qualifiers',
+    '-Wenum-conversion',
     '-DGDK_DISABLE_DEPRECATED',
     '-DGMIME_DISABLE_DEPRECATED',
     '-DGTK_DISABLE_DEPRECATED',


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]